Job Summary

To provide valuable financial support services to the University community. This includes assisting in the preparation of accounting reports, reconciling the daily cash receipts, processing DR daily journals, processing working funds, and processing student refunds. Review and approval of daily cash journals. This position also assists faculty and staff with various accounting needs.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Reconcile daily cash receipting.
  • Process student refund pay cycle & Mail AP & Student Refund Checks.
  • Assist University Community with questions and accounting needs.
  • Review and approve daily cash receipting entries.
  • Prepare reports and reconciliations.
  • Process returned checks in mail.
  • DR Daily Journal Processing.
  • Review Working Fund requests for approval, reconcile working fund balances, assist UTA departments with working fund procedures, including closing working funds.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Required Qualifications

    Three years of experience in governmental or commercial accounting.

    Preferred Qualifications

    Bachelor's degree in accounting or equivalent experience in Higher Education Experience in PeopleSoft Financials and Campus Solutions Strong computer skills including MS Excel
